We offer growth opportunities and a positive, supportive culture. Role ACCESS South Bay is looking for a Neurology Veterinary Technician to join the Thrive Pet Healthcare network. As a Neurology Veterinary Technician you’ll play an important role in pets’ lives by providing end-to-end care for our patients. Your work ranges from hands-on care for outpatient treatments and laboratory tests to support services including admitting and discharging patients. Role Responsibilities Strong client communication skills are a must: technicians obtain histories, present treatment plans, review discharge instructions and medications, and provide client education on complex diseases treated by Internal Medicine Anesthetic induction (RVTs) and monitoring of sensitive and potentially critically ill patients for advanced diagnostic procedures (CT, endoscopy, bone marrow aspirates, joint taps, and more) Monitor and perform treatments for patients requiring intensive management, recognize significant changes in the patient’s condition, and notify the Doctor Communicate with clients about individualized pet health concerns and offer guidance on Thrive Membership options, medications, and additional treatments Assist in maintaining relevant, comprehensive medical records with the support of practice systems Obtain relevant health history and information from clients and maintain medical charts Use safe restraining techniques, follow standard protocols, and sustain clean, sterile, organized treatment areas, exam rooms, and labs Be willing to guide, mentor, and support fellow team members Experience & Skills Requirements Veterinary technician licensure preferred 1-2 years of clinical experience An Associate’s or Bachelor’s degree from an AVMA-accredited veterinary technology program preferred; or the equivalent combination of education, training and experience that provides the required knowledge, skills, and abilities You’ll Grow With Us Here, you can grow your career through access to comprehensive learning and skillset programs.
